Understanding the Phospholipid Antibody IgM Test
The Phospholipid Antibody IgM Test represents a critical diagnostic tool in modern immunopathology, specifically designed to detect immunoglobulin M antibodies that target phospholipids in your bloodstream. Phospholipids are essential components of cell membranes throughout your body, and when your immune system mistakenly produces antibodies against them, it can lead to serious autoimmune conditions. This test plays a vital role in identifying antiphospholipid syndrome (APS), a disorder characterized by abnormal blood clotting and pregnancy complications.
What Does This Test Measure?
The Phospholipid Antibody IgM Test specifically measures the presence and concentration of IgM class antibodies directed against various phospholipids, including:
- Cardiolipin antibodies
- Phosphatidylserine antibodies
- Beta-2 glycoprotein I antibodies
- Other phospholipid-binding proteins
Using advanced Enzyme Immunoassay methodology, this test provides precise quantitative measurements of IgM antibody levels, helping healthcare providers determine the severity of autoimmune activity and guide appropriate treatment decisions.
Who Should Consider This Test?
This specialized immunopathology test is recommended for individuals experiencing specific symptoms or medical conditions, including:
Primary Indications
- Unexplained Thrombosis: Patients with recurrent blood clots in arteries or veins without obvious cause
- Recurrent Pregnancy Loss: Women experiencing multiple miscarriages, particularly in the second or third trimester
- Autoimmune Symptoms: Individuals with features suggestive of autoimmune disorders
- Pre-eclampsia or Eclampsia: Women with severe pregnancy-related hypertension complications
- Unexplained Stroke: Younger patients with cerebrovascular events without traditional risk factors
Additional Risk Factors
- Family history of autoimmune diseases
- Previous diagnosis of lupus or related conditions
- Unexplained thrombocytopenia (low platelet count)
- Livedo reticularis (mottled skin appearance)
- Unexplained heart valve abnormalities

Understanding Your Test Results
Interpretation Guidelines
Your Phospholipid Antibody IgM test results will be interpreted by our expert immunopathology team:
Negative Results
- Normal IgM antibody levels detected
- Lower risk for antiphospholipid syndrome-related complications
- May require follow-up testing if clinical suspicion remains high
Positive Results
- Elevated IgM antibodies against phospholipids
- Suggests possible antiphospholipid syndrome
- Requires confirmation with repeat testing after 12 weeks
- May indicate need for anticoagulation therapy
- Warrants comprehensive evaluation by a specialist
Borderline Results
- Results near the cutoff value
- May require repeat testing
- Clinical correlation with symptoms essential
- Consideration of additional antiphospholipid antibody testing
